Carrarese Calcio
Carrarese Calcio 1908, commonly referred to as Carrarese, is an Italian football club based in Carrara, Tuscany. It currently plays in Serie C, having last been in Serie B in 1948. History The club was founded in 1908. In the season 2010–11 from Lega Pro Seconda Divisione group B, Carrarese was promoted in the play-off to Lega Pro Prima Divisione. In 2016 Carrarese Calcio S.r.l. went bankrupt. A new company Carrarese Calcio 1908 S.r.l., successfully bid the sports title by refurbished the debt of Carrarese Calcio S.r.l. Colours and badge The team's colours are light blue and yellow. Ownership Italian international and Juventus goalkeeper Gianluigi Buffon (a native of Carrara and prominent supporter of the club) was a major shareholder of the club, as part of a consortium that acquired the club in 2010; other shareholders included former Pisa Calcio chairman Maurizio Mian and long-time Serie A striker Cristiano Lucarelli. Società A Responsabilità Limitata
''Società a responsabilità limitata'' (S.r.l. or srl) is a kind of legal corporate entity in Italy, which literally means (but is not entirely equal to) limited liability company. It has a similar form to ''società sportiva dilettantistica a responsabilità limitata'' (S.s.d a r.l.) for amateur sports-related companies and their corresponding regulations: article 90 of the Italian Law №289 of 2002. Differing from ''società per azioni'' (S.p.A.), S.r.l. may not issue shares that have par value, but only the quota ( it, quote) or units of the share capital. Moreover, the articles of association of S.r.l. allowed different allocations of profits and assets, which was more comparable to a limited partnership. A fourth form of corporate entity, "''società cooperativa a responsabilità limitata''" (S.c.r.l. or S.c. a r.l.), was seen in the cooperatives of Italy. References

Antonio Marino
Antonio Marino (born 9 August 1988) is an Italian footballer who plays as a defender for club Latina. Career Marino started his career with amateur Eccellenza club Folgore Selinunte from Castelvetrano, until he was noticed by Udinese scout and former Italy international footballer Andrea Carnevale. He successively agreed to join the ''Primavera'' under-20 team of Udinese, also serving as team captain throughout the 2007–08 season. He then spent the 2008–09 season on loan to Lega Pro Prima Divisione club Juve Stabia, where he collected 15 first team appearances. In July 2009 Marino was loaned out again, this time to Serie B outfit Ascoli. After making fourteen appearances in his first full season at Serie B level, his loan deal was then extended also for the following 2010–11 season. Pierluigi Pinto
Pierluigi Pinto (born 22 September 1998) is an Italian football player. He plays as a defender for club Carrarese. Career Fiorentina Born in Brindisi, Pinto was a youth exponent of Fiorentina. Loan to Arezzo On 13 July 2018, Pinto and Luca Mosti were loaned to Serie C club Arezzo on a season-long loan deal. On 16 September he made his professional debut, in Serie C, for Arezzo in a 1–0 away win over Lucchese, he played the entire match. He became Arezzo's first-choice early in the season. From September 2018 to March 2019 he played 29 consecutive entire matches until he was replaced by Lorenzo Burzigotti in the 57th minute of a 3–0 away defeat against Carrarese. Pinto ended his season-long to Arezzo with 37 appearances, including 36 as a starter, and he helped the club to reach the qurter-finals of the play-off, however the lost 4–2 on aggregate against Pisa. Giacomo Satalino
Giacomo Satalino (born 20 May 1999) is an Italian professional foot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for club Reggiana, on loan from Sassuolo. Club career Fiorentina Satalino started playing for Serie A side Fiorentina's under-19 squad in the 2015–16 season. In that season and the next, he appeared on the bench as a backup for the senior squad 26 times in different competitions, but did not see any time on the field. Sassuolo In July 2017, Satalino transferred to fellow-Serie A club Sassuolo, and spent the 2017–18 season in their under-19 squad. In the 2018–19 season, he appeared on the bench for the senior squad 17 times, but again did not see any field time. Loan to Renate On 31 July 2019, Satalino joined Serie C club Renate on a season-long loan. He made his professional league debut on 25 August 2019, in a season-opening game against Giana Erminio. Spezia Calcio
Spezia Calcio is a professional Association football, football club based in La Spezia, Liguria, Italy. Spezia Calcio was founded in 1906 by the Swiss banker Hermann Hurni (or Hurny in some documents), who played for the early Crystal Palace amateur teams in London during his time there as a student. He played for Crystal Palace again in 1909. The first Spezia playing kit, light blue and white, was a second-hand amateur Crystal Palace kit donated to Hurny when he returned to La Spezia. In 1911, following the decision of Alberto Picco and others to honour Pro Vercelli as an example of a small team able to beat the big teams, a plain white shirt was adopted with black shorts and black socks, which is still in use today. In the 1920s prior to the creation of Serie A, Spezia played several top league games against the giants of Italian football including AC Milan, Juventus, and Inter Milan.
